Technical Field
The utility model relates to the technical field of building dust fall equipment, in particular to a dust fall device for building construction.
Background
Along with the promotion of building engineering, constructor can change indoor construction from outdoor, can produce the dust in indoor construction, and the dust is inside to have harmful granule simultaneously, and constructor can breathe in with the dust suction in the during operation, and constructor's lung can appear the disease long time.
In order to protect the body of constructors, the dust falling device needs to be placed indoors, the existing dust falling device for building construction is used indoors, dust in the air is usually suppressed through water spraying, but when the dust on the ground rises again after moisture is dried, the dust falling effect is poor, effective dust falling cannot be achieved, water resource waste is serious, and therefore the dust falling device for building construction is provided.

Detailed Description

Referring to fig. 1-3, the present utility model provides a technical solution: a dust fall device for construction, comprising: the collecting box 2 is fixedly connected with the inner bottom wall of the returning plate 1, the suction fan 3 is fixedly arranged on the inner bottom wall of the returning plate 1, the air inlet end of the suction fan 3 is communicated with the air suction pipe 4, one end of the air suction pipe 4 is communicated with the collecting box 2, the upper surface of the collecting box 2 is communicated with the air inlet pipe 5, one end of the air inlet pipe 5 penetrates through the returning plate 1, the connecting plate 11 is fixedly connected with the upper surface of the returning plate 1, the bottom plate 6 is fixedly connected with the top of the connecting plate 11, the electric telescopic rod 7 is fixedly arranged on the upper surface of the bottom plate 6, the disc-shaped atomizing spray head 8 is fixedly arranged at the telescopic end of the electric telescopic rod 7, the water pump 9 is fixedly arranged on the upper surface of the returning plate 1, the water outlet end of the water pump 9 is communicated with the water outlet pipe 10, and one end of the water outlet pipe 10 is communicated with the water inlet of the disc-shaped atomizing spray head 8.
In this embodiment, specific: the outside of bottom plate 6 and return plate 1 is all fixedly connected with tapered plate 12, through the setting of bottom plate 6 and return plate 1 upper cone plate 12, makes things convenient for outside gas to get into between bottom plate 6 and the return plate 1.
In this embodiment, specific: the filter screen 13 is installed to the inside wall of collecting box 2, through the setting of filter screen 13, blocks off aspiration channel 4, prevents that the dust from getting into inside the suction fan 3.
In this embodiment, specific: the lower surface of collecting box 2 communicates there is discharging pipe 14, and collecting box 2 and return plate 1 are run through to the one end of discharging pipe 14, through the setting of discharging pipe 14, conveniently discharges the dust in the collecting box 2.
In this embodiment, specific: the front surface of the collection box 2 is provided with an observation window 15, and the interior of the collection box 2 is conveniently observed through the arrangement of the observation window 15.
In this embodiment, specific: four universal wheels 16 are symmetrically and fixedly arranged on the lower surface of the return-shaped plate 1, and the device is convenient to move while the return-shaped plate 1 is supported through the arrangement of the universal wheels 16.
Working principle: this device is in the in-process of using, remove this device to the position of use through universal wheel 16, then start suction fan 3 and water pump 9, suction fan 3 is through aspiration channel 4 and air-supply line 5 to bottom plate 6 and the gas suction around the back shaped plate 1 collect box 2 in, let the back filter the gas through filter screen 13 for collect the dust in the air in collecting box 2, the inlet end and the raceway intercommunication of water pump 9, water pump 9 is with water through outlet pipe 10 discharge disc atomizer 8 in, disc atomizer 8 produces water smoke and carries out the dust fall to the dust in the surrounding air, and when need adjusting the dust fall height, start electric telescopic handle 7 and drive disc atomizer 8 and remove, thereby adjust the atomizer height.
